Featured dishes

View full menu
Garlic Bread
Pizza bread, garlic infused olive oil, oregano, touch of sea salt baked in wood fired oven
Mari Fritti
Hand scored and dusted in our secret crumbs cooked to perfection served with spicy aloli
Green Lip Mussels
Cooked in red wine, napolitan sauce, garlic and chilli
Seafood Linguine
Marlborough mussels, cloudy bay clams, calamari, king prawn a hint of chilli in a light seafood sauce
Spinaci Conchiglioni
Pasta shells filled with spinach, zany zeus ricotta, mozzarella and hint of nutmeg cooked in chef's special napolitan sauce

Cin Cin is a true Italian Restaurant in Wellington, NZ. We dined on the Tuesday after New Years and the place was packed. Worth noting there was no holiday surcharge!

We started with a bottle of Chianti and ordered "Garlic Bread" made with Pizza bread, Garlic infused olive oil, oregano, touch of sea salt – baked in wood fired oven and then "Bruschetta Italiana" toasted bread rubbed with garlic topped with rocket, ricotta and fresh tomatoes drizzled with olive oil and balsamic for appetizers. The appetizers were good but the bread on the Bruschetta was non eventful.

We followed with entrees of "Conchiglioni Spinaci" prepared with Pasta shells filled with spinach, Zany Zeus ricotta, mozzarella and hint of nutmeg cooked in chef’s special napolitan sauce, " Wow really enjoyed this dish. Then a serving of Wild Rabbit Ravioli" made with Home-made Ravioli filled w/ slow braised wild rabbit served with a light napolitan sauce. Highly recommend the the Rabbit Ravs! Then "Lasagna" layers of organic beef Bolognese, mozzarella, parmesan and béchamel served with salad. The lasagna was needed a little more zing for me. Our last entree was "Risotto Wild Mushroom" Saffron infused risotto cooked with Portobello & wild mushrooms and a hint of gorgonzola. Good as well.

Our meals were very good and the service was excellent. Highly...
